The rank (0–100) uses a weighted average of the Sharpe, Sortino, Omega, Calmar, and Martin percentile ranks for the trailing 12 months. Higher means stronger historical risk-adjusted performance within the peer group.

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.

With a correlation of 0.94, IXN and XLKI move almost identically. Holding both adds very little diversification - you're essentially doubling your position in the same market segment. Choosing one is usually more capital-efficient.

IXN has higher volatility (10.37%) compared to XLKI (8.68%). In terms of maximum drawdown, IXN dropped -55.67% vs XLKI's -11.21%.

On 1-year performance, IXN leads with 42.54% vs 24.59% for XLKI. On fees, XLKI is cheaper at 0.35% per year. On volatility, XLKI has been the lower-risk option at 8.68%. The better choice depends on whether you care most about return, fees, risk, or income.

Over the 1-year period, IXN has performed better with a 42.54% return vs 24.59%. Past performance does not guarantee future results, so compare this with risk, fees, and fund exposure.

XLKI is cheaper with a 0.35% expense ratio, compared with 0.46% for IXN.

XLKI has the higher dividend yield at 17.91%, compared with 0.83% for IXN.
